Check out some of Indiana’s most interesting people and places – from the transcontinental cyclists of Upland, to the Anderson folks working with retired racehorses, the Corn-Fed Derby Dames and the people of Muncie’s historic neighborhoods.
Each week we introduce you to some of the people making a difference and find the fun things to see and do across the region. Join us each Friday at 6:30 p.m. after the news and Sundays at 3:00 p.m.
Host John Strauss is a college journalism instructor and longtime Indiana reporter who likes finding stories off the beaten path. He’s a former AP correspondent and editor in Indiana, Tennessee, Kentucky and New York City, whose last professional assignment was with The Indianapolis Star as a digital-news and weekend city editor. John now teaches journalism at Ball State University and serves as adviser to the student-run Daily News.
